Biography of 50 Cent
Born Curtis James Jackson III on July 6, 1975, in Queens, New York, 50 Cent rose from humble beginnings to become one of the most influential figures in hip-hop. His early life was marked by the challenges of growing up in a single-parent household after his mother, Sabrina, passed away when he was just eight years old. Raised by his grandmother, 50 Cent found himself embroiled in the street life of South Jamaica, a neighborhood notorious for its crime and poverty.

What Led to the Shooting Incident?
The shooting incident that would forever alter 50 Cent's life occurred on May 24, 2000. Prior to this, he had been making a name for himself in the underground rap scene, attracting attention from major record labels. However, his involvement in the drug trade and the dangerous environment he navigated daily made him a target for rival factions and individuals with grudges.
How Many Times Was 50 Cent Shot?
On that fateful day, 50 Cent was shot nine times outside his grandmother's home in South Jamaica, Queens. The attack left him with bullet wounds in his hand, arm, hip, both legs, chest, and left cheek. Despite the severity of his injuries, 50 Cent remarkably survived, a testament to his resilience and fighting spirit.
